Psychology is one of the most popular majors in the nation, ranking 8th of all the majors we analyze. In 2020-2021, 195,678 degrees were awarded to students with this major. In 2019-2020, psychology graduates who were awarded their degree in 2017-2019, earned an average of $35,611 and had an average of $25,989 in loans still to pay off.
Across Iowa, there were 1,447 psychology graduates with average earnings and debt of $35,403 and $34,513 respectively. At the master’s degree level specifically, there were 58 psychology graduates with average earnings and debt of $53,865 and $0 respectively.
